Vellayoor

Vellayoor is a small village in Kalikavu Panchayat, Nilambur taluk in Malappuram district in the state of Kerala.

Vellayoor

Vellayoor is a small village in Kalikavu Panchayat, Nilambur taluk in Malappuram district in the state of Kerala.